BUG-883: Fan-out backpressure misconfigured on Pebblecast staging

So the notification fan-out has been dropping messages because FANOUT_MAX_INFLIGHT is unset and defaults to unlimited — the downstream queue just chokes. Set it to 200 in staging's .env. While you're in there, the relay auth secret is also missing after Friday's rotation. Put the secret on the line right after the inflight setting.

sealed setting: LEDGER_TOKEN13=5d842615a26d7

== Transporting Permit Blueprints ==

This page covers moving the stamped blueprint set for the Larkspur Quay permit application. The drawings are originals from Hollis & Brame Architects and cannot be reprinted before the filing deadline. Transport them flat in the grey tube case, never rolled loose. The driver should confirm the tube seal is intact before departure and again on arrival. At the hand-over point, the courier must follow this instruction:

handover note for yagef-bagep: the drudor pelius courier leaves the kasdor zorvan norir ledger at gate 8016 under passcode 755406

// RATE_LIMIT_DEFAULT_RPS
//
// Default per-client rate limit for the Hollowgate internal API gateway.
// Support: do not raise this for individual tenants; use the override
// table instead. Changes here require a gateway redeploy and reset all
// in-flight token buckets, which briefly spikes 429s. If a customer
// reports throttling, confirm their gateway build first by matching
// the token that appears below.

pipeline stamp: htk31_f769b577b3028a4e9958e5bb8d1259a

Subject: DR drill recap — Crashline pipeline

Hey folks, quick summary before the sync. We ran the disaster-recovery drill on the Crashline crash-report pipeline Tuesday. Failover to the Velden region took 11 minutes — ingest lagged but nothing dropped, and symbolication caught up within the hour. One gap: the restore step for the dedup store needs manual unlock, which only Tomas knew about. To fix the bus-factor problem, I'm documenting everything in the runbook, including the unlock credential, which I'm pasting just below.

vault phrase of hahop-badug = novvan-ulaion-zorius-noviel-gorwyn-casix-tamys